Output 5afe42cf9d6cd919d280a5dc1d3050e94c39fe0300af7ad0166bc21d1758e4b0:42

value
4626605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 668475c21928ba26e0986f42df5a8fc4cf2e441f OP_EQUAL
address
MHFDqUi6LxXdgay6uKvGc3sf3eEZG8r83z
transaction
5afe42cf9d6cd919d280a5dc1d3050e94c39fe0300af7ad0166bc21d1758e4b0
spent
true